Go to the directory where Jamstix was installed. Find the jamstix.dll and make a copy. Then go to the directory where you have your other vst's and vsti's located and paste it in. (If you didn't specify a unique directory it will be Program Filess/Reaper/Plugins/VST (At least for me on XP)
It should now show up fine when you ad an FX.
Jamstix takes a little getting used to if you have used other drum programs before, but once you get it, you will never go back;-) |

Open up Reaper and go to Options/Preferences/Plug-ins/VST
The directory you need should be listed there. You could also just enter the path to where jamstix was installed (separated by a semicolon), but at least I prefer to keep all my effects and instruments in a single location. |
